The period of vibe coding — the observe of building software program by describing what you need in plain English and letting artificial intelligence deal with the remainder — is here.
The AI company Anthropic not too long ago sponsored a hackathon that drew 13,000 candidates — and most of the winners weren’t engineers and even in tech. It’s the most recent signal that the longer term of innovation belongs to the people who perceive issues, not essentially the people who can code.
“There’s always been a tech barrier between domain expertise and coding,” mentioned Dr. Michał Nedoszytko, an interventional heart specialist primarily based in Brussels who took third place within the competitors. “[But now] if anyone has enough expertise, they can create advanced solutions. Programming is solved.”

A source close to Anthropic famous that the company’s hackathons have seen a surge in submissions from non-technical candidates over the past six months.
Nedoszytko tinkered with code for years however may by no means fairly bridge the hole between his medical experience and the merchandise he envisioned building. But developments in AI over the previous few months alone modified that.

He constructed PostVisit.ai, a platform that guides sufferers after they depart the physician’s workplace. Too usually, sufferers stroll out of appointments overwhelmed and confused, PostVisit.ai explains their prognosis and therapy plan in easy language online.
“Healthcare is being redefined,” Nedoszytko mentioned.
First place went to lawyer Mike Brown for CrossBeam — a instrument that cuts by means of California’s tedious allowing course of for accent dwelling items.

Other winners included an digital musician who constructed a generative AI band, and an Ugandan infrastructure employee whose instrument turns highway footage into investment suggestions.
The competitors provided $100,000 in Claude API credit — tokens that permit builders entry and construct with Anthropic’s AI fashions — cut up amongst winners, and challenged individuals to construct instruments utilizing the company’s new Opus 4.6 model and Claude Code, its agentic coding instrument.
Wall Street is bullish on the developments. “This is going to create so much more innovation… we will be able to harness so much brain power,” Dan Ives, the veteran tech analyst at Wedbush Securities, instructed me. “This is not going to structurally unseat tech companies — it’s the democratization of coding.”
He added. “This is the Jetsons, not the Flintstones.”
